It is sort of a cross between the exaggerated height and texture (à la Brigitte Bardot) seen at the Mulberry s/s 2012 show and the looped under pony tail (or so I would like to think). Curls, volume and up dos are currently dominating the catwalks. Luckily I am blessed with curly locks, which make embracing these hair trends fairly easy. 

Whether you've got curly tresses or poker straight hair you can achieve this look easily. Well, first you might want to curl your hair - tongs and perms are back in vogue this season. After that, follow these simple steps:

1. Tie hair up in a high pony tail and separate a lock of hair.



2. Wrap the lock twice or more around the loose hair of the pony tail.


3. Hook your finger under the top of a bobby pin and slide it in catching the loose strand first and the centre of the bottom end of the pony tail after that.


4. Make sure the pin is secured tightly and not visible (somewhat lost in your hair). And you should end up with something like this:
